Direct flights between Turkiye and Armenia are set to resume, with the first Yerevan-Istanbul flight landing at Istanbul Airport later today

Flights between Turkiye and Armenia are set to resume with the first flight from Yerevan to Istanbul.

Pegasus Airlines will operate flights between Istanbul and Yerevan thrice a week, according to Turkiye's Transport and Infrastructure Ministry.The Pegasus flights from Istanbul’s Sabiha Gokcen Airport to Yerevan will take place on Mondays, Thursdays and Saturdays, and from Yerevan to Istanbul on Tuesdays, Fridays and Sundays.In 2019, 61,431 passengers were transported between the two countries. The flight time takes two hours.

"It is good that there are flights between Turkiye and Armenia. When it comes to trade, it is possible to bring very high-quality goods from Turkiye. We want to see Armenian products in the shops in Turkiye," said Dorunts.
